September hearings seen as test for FDA

By admin
Created Aug 22 2005 - 8:01pm

The Food and Drug Administration will review three potential blockbuster drugs in early September. Observers say the agency may raise the bar after the high profile drug safety stories of the last year. The three new drugs include Pfizer's inhaled insulin Exubera and two drugs developed by Bristol-Myers Squibb: the new rheumatoid arthritis treatment Orencia, and Pargluva, which targets adult-onset diabetes.
